Which is Greater: 0.5 or 0.55?

When we compare two numbers, it's essential to understand their values and positions on the number line. In this article, we'll explore which is greater between 0.5 and 0.55.

Comparing 0.5 and 0.55

To determine which number is greater, let's look at the decimal values:

  • 0.5 has one digit after the decimal point, which is 5.
  • 0.55 has two digits after the decimal point, 5 and 5.

Since 0.55 has a non-zero digit (5) in the hundredths place, it's clear that 0.55 is greater than 0.5.

Visualizing on the Number Line

Imagine a number line with 0 at the center. Moving to the right, we have positive numbers, and moving to the left, we have negative numbers. Let's plot 0.5 and 0.55 on the number line:

As we can see, 0.55 is located to the right of 0.5, indicating that it's greater.
